Output cccacd333b5672f14de71db415a922e35f89056f383e6f0634582653b086d038:30

value
3708477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b9938520bd3af971f9f667e895819d0e40a28c OP_EQUAL
address
34wutKcY4anBEAwJszGT7AydT1xXMbpZr2
transaction
cccacd333b5672f14de71db415a922e35f89056f383e6f0634582653b086d038
spent
true